Included tools:
- alsactl: advanced controls for ALSA sound drivers
- alsaloop: create loopbacks between PCM capture and playback devices
- alsamixer: curses mixer
- alsaucm: alsa use case manager
- amixer: command line mixer
- amidi: read from and write to ALSA RawMIDI ports
- aplay, arecord: command line playback and recording
- aplaymidi, arecordmidi: command line MIDI playback and recording
- aconnect, aseqnet, aseqdump: command line MIDI sequencer control
- iecset: set or dump IEC958 status bits
- speaker-test: speaker test tone generator

Anacron (like "anac(h)ronistic") is a periodic command scheduler. It executes commands at intervals specified in days. Unlike cron, it does not assume that the system is running continuously. It can therefore be used to control the execution of daily, weekly, and monthly jobs (or anything with a period of n days), on systems that don't run 24 hours a day. When installed and configured properly, Anacron will make sure that the commands are run at the specified intervals as closely as machine uptime permits.
